Understanding the cost structure is a key part of the process. The price of a personal cleaner can vary significantly based on several factors. Typically, cleaners charge either by the hour or by the job. An hourly rate provides flexibility if the cleaning time varies, while a flat rate for the entire job offers cost certainty. Major factors influencing cost include the size of your home (square footage and number of bedrooms/bathrooms), the overall condition and current level of clutter, the frequency of service (regular clients often get better rates), and your geographic location. It’s always advisable to get quotes from several providers to understand the market rate in your area.
Finding a reliable and trustworthy personal cleaner is perhaps the most critical step. There are several avenues to explore. Personal recommendations from friends, family, or neighbors are often the most reliable source. You can also use reputable online platforms that vet and background-check their cleaners, providing reviews and insured services. Alternatively, you might consider local cleaning companies that employ teams of cleaners. Each option has its pros and cons; independent cleaners may offer more personalized service, while companies can provide backup if your regular cleaner is unavailable.
Once you have a shortlist of candidates, the interview process is vital. Whether conducted over the phone or in person, this is your opportunity to assess their suitability. Prepare a list of questions to ask potential cleaners. Essential questions include inquiring about their experience and references, whether they are insured and bonded (this protects you in case of accident or damage), if they bring their own supplies and equipment or if you need to provide them, and their specific cleaning process. A walk-through of your home is highly recommended. This allows the cleaner to see the space, understand your expectations, and provide an accurate quote. It also gives you a chance to see how they communicate and whether you feel comfortable with them in your home.
To ensure a successful and long-term relationship with your personal cleaner, clear communication and mutual respect are paramount. On the first cleaning day, be available to answer questions and provide any necessary instructions. It is also wise to secure your valuables, such as cash, jewelry, and important documents, to avoid any potential misunderstandings. Establishing clear ground rules from the outset is beneficial. Discuss logistics like parking, access to your home (whether you will be there or they will use a key), and any off-limit areas. Providing constructive feedback is also important; if something isn’t done to your standard, communicate it politely so it can be corrected next time. Remember, a good working relationship is built on respect and clear expectations.
For those who are budget-conscious but still desire a cleaner home, there are alternatives to a full-service personal cleaner. You could hire a cleaner for specific, high-effort tasks like deep cleaning the bathrooms and kitchen every few weeks, while maintaining the general tidiness yourself. Another option is to use a cleaning team for a one-time, thorough deep clean to get your home to a baseline level of cleanliness, which is then easier to maintain on your own. “Clean as you go” habits can also significantly reduce the need for extensive cleaning sessions.
